Overview

Pushed to the breaking point by Simon, her psychologically abusive boyfriend, Alice becomes an unwitting participant in an intervention staged by her two closest friends while on vacation. As she rediscovers the essence of herself and gains some much-needed perspective, she slowly starts to fray the cords of codependency that bind her. However, Simon's vengeance is as inevitable as it is shattering, and once unleashed, it tests her strength, her courage, and the bonds of deep-rooted friendships.

Summary

"Alice, Darling - Sometimes the hardest thing to see is the truth." is english Language Movie.

"Alice, Darling" was released on 30 December 2022 it had a budget of $4,000,000 and had box office collection of $121,067.

The movie was directed by Mary Nighy
